This gearing comprises a-' bevel wheel 6 mounted on the spindle b of the tens and hundreds switch .B which bevel wheel gears with a similar wheel b'* on a spindle B carrying a worm b that gears "with a worm wheel b connected to the thousands and tens "of thousands switchB through the intervention of a clutch device. This clutch device comprises in the example shown a disk B having a sleeve 6 which is rotatably mounted on the spindle b of the switch B and on the inner end of which the aforesaid worm wheel I) is rigidly mounted. The said spindle b is provided at its outer end with a disk B which bears against the outer surface of the disk B connected'to theworm wheel. The disk B is furnished'with a handle a 6? and with a spring plunger B which normally engages as shown with a hole 7) in the disk ,B". The
said plunger, which is arranged in the handle b serveswhen in its engaging position with the hole 6 to transmit the movement of the disk 21?, connected to the worm wheel 6 to the switch B (this worm wheel being driven through theaforesaid gearing,
from a'handle Zr" with which the tens and hundreds switch B is provided). When however the spring plungerB is moved out of operative engagement between the two "disks by moving the handle I) away from its disks Bi, the latter can be actuated by its handle to angularly displace the switch B independently of thetens and hundreds switch B" and without necessitating'the disconnection of the aforesaid bevel and worm. gearing. In this manner the motor A can be causedto actuate the thousands drum a 'in accordance with the amount of displace- -ment given to the switch so that increments of thousands of yards range can be quickly transmitted independently of the range that is transmitted by the switch B. The hole 6 in the disk B insures that the reengagement of the spring plunger B therewith shall take place only after the handle 79 of the tens and hundreds switch B has been actuated to cause the disk B to be angularly displaced to an extent corresponding to the "'displacenient'of the handle I) of the thous: ands and tens of thousands switch B in transmitting the ,large increment of ,range. a

We wish it to be understood that we do not desire to limit the invention to the herein described arrangement of counting drums, nor to the number of motors employed and the number of drums that each motor drives. For example instead of the drum of lowest value constituting the tens drum and being graduated in steps of twenty-five as in the example herein described, it may be graduated in units, and the'drum of highest value in thousands or in tens of'thousands. Inthe former case (i. e. where the drum. of highest value is graduated in thousands) there would be four drums, and when two motors are employed, each would drive twodrums; in the latter case (2'. e. where the drum of highest value is graduated in tens of thousands) there would be five drums, and one motor would drive the units, tens and hundreds and the other would drive the thou-. f sands and tens of thousands drums. 15.1 r c.
